Nobel Prize Winning Former Pupil to Visit School
This Thursday 7th June, former pupil Dr Richard Henderson (leaver 1962) is coming to visit the school.
He is a joint recipient of the Nobel prize for Chemistry 2017.
Dr Henderson will tour the new school and then will have lunch with the Head teacher and some staff as well as some former pupils from his year group.
He will then address some 240 senior science pupils about his journey to becoming a Nobel Prize winner in Chemistry before conducting a science master class with about 50 Advanced Higher science pupils.
Dr Henderson will then be our guest of honour at our annual awards ceremony in the evening and as well as making an address to the audience, he will present the Molly T Hope award to the Senior School Champion.
For those pupils and staff who don’t have a chance to be part of the scheduled events above, there is an opportunity to come to the dual teaching area on the 3rd floor at 3.30pm where Dr Henderson will be until about 4pm.

City Parent, Carer Survey 17/18
Thank you to all who took part in the 2017.18 parent carer survey.
The City have now collated the results for Boroughmuir High School as well as a summary report of all school returns across the City.
The Reports are available to view on our web site in the School Information / Policies and Documents section.
